Job Summary:
As part of this immersive 10-week program, you’ll gain hands-on experience working alongside a best-in-class marketing team within a first-class organization. This internship supports the Marketing department in executing paid and owned initiatives that drive fan engagement, ticket sales, membership renewals, and brand awareness throughout the season. The ideal candidate is eager to learn, communicates effectively, and enjoys collaborating in a fast-paced, creative environment. You will have the opportunity to contribute on both game and non-game days, gaining a comprehensive view of how marketing operates during the season.
In addition to your day-to-day responsibilities, you’ll have opportunities to connect with leaders across the organization through a series of leadership-led coffee chats and networking events designed to broaden your understanding of the professional sports industry.
All the responsibilities we will trust you with:
- Exemplifying our Padres Core Values/Mission Statement: Communication and Collaboration, Progress and Innovation, Accountability and Integrity, and Effort and Results, through building meaningful connections with a diverse fan base and serving as impactful leaders in the San Diego community
- Shadow the Marketing department and train in a variety of tasks related to owned and paid media
- Learn about aspects of an omnichannel marketing campaign that supports business goals
- Gain exposure to marketing team meetings, and other related roles including social media, fan engagement, video production, graphic design, and in-game entertainment
- Assist with the creation of promotional talking points, radio copy, marketing emails, and digital ad copy
- Support with media partnerships, including but not limited to drop-in copy, media packages, and fulfilling prize packs
- Aid in the execution of the giveaway marketing plan, as well as the distribution day of game
- Build reports that recap campaign efforts for sponsors and senior leadership
- Analyze results of email marketing campaigns, digital ad campaigns, and provide suggestions and input
- Help the marketing team with various projects that may require organization, research, and brainstorming
- Completes a dedicated project with the understanding that it would be presented to leadership at the end of the internship
- Support various other projects that may be assigned on a weekly or one-off basis
- Other duties and projects as assigned

Pay and additional compensation:
Per the California pay transparency law, the hourly pay rate for this position is $21.06. Part time, non-union employees are subject to the San Diego Living Wage Ordinance and rates will increase accordingly.
In addition to your hourly rate, the Padres offer PTO, employee discounts, appreciation, and recognition opportunities.
